Frequently asked questions
Which vehicle is cheaper between the Denza D9 PHEV and the Nissan Z?
The Denza D9 PHEV costs ₱4,298,000 while the Nissan Z costs ₱3,988,000. The Denza is more expensive by ₱310,000.
Which vehicle has better power output?
The Nissan Z produces significantly more power with 383 PS compared to the Denza D9 PHEV's 129 PS.
